Delphi-PRAXiS

Delphi-PRAXiS (https://www.delphipraxis.net/forum.php)
-   Datenbanken (https://www.delphipraxis.net/15-datenbanken/)
-   -   Delphi Datenimport & Defaultwerte (https://www.delphipraxis.net/69232-datenimport-defaultwerte.html)

Moony 12. Mai 2006 08:49

Datenbank: MYSQL • Zugriff über: ADO

Datenimport & Defaultwerte
 
Hallo zusammen,

Wie schon der Titel sagt möchte ich einen Datenimport auf die MySQL-Datenbank durchführen. Das erledige ich mit dem folgenden Befehl:
Delphi-Quellcode:
LOAD DATA LOCAL INFILE "Dateiname" REPLACE INTO TABLE Tabelle
Das funktioniert einwandfrei. Mein Problem besteht darin, dass es sein kann, dass in der Datei einige Felder nicht gefüllt sind. In der Tabelle werden diese Felder jedoch mit NOT NULL definiert und haben auch einen Defaultwert zugewiesen bekommen. Leider werden diese vordefinierten Felder dennoch nicht gefüllt. Kann man das etwas machen oder gibt es da einen speziellen SQL-Befehl?

Ich hoffe mir kann jemand weiterhelfen. :gruebel:

Gruß, Moony

shmia 12. Mai 2006 11:55

Re: Datenimport & Defaultwerte
 
Ganz klar ist, dass der MySQL Server die Datei importiert und du keinerlei Eingriffsmöglichkeiten hast.
Also kann dir nur das MYSQL Team helfen.
Du kannst deinen Bugreport dort in den Foren oder in der Online Doku abliefern:
http://dev.mysql.com/doc/refman/4.1/...ng-tables.html


Alle Zeitangaben in WEZ +1. Es ist jetzt 06:24 Uhr.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z